JetKVM is a high-performance, open-source KVM over IP (Keyboard, Video, Mouse) solution designed for efficient remote management of computers, servers, and workstations. Whether you're dealing with boot failures, installing a new operating system, adjusting BIOS settings, or simply taking control of a machine from afar, JetKVM provides the tools to get it done effectively.

Development
This project is built with Node.JS, Prisma and Express.
To start the development server, run:
# For local development, you can use the following command to start a postgres instanc
# Don't use in production
docker run --name jetkvm-cloud-db \
-e POSTGRES_USER=jetkvm \
-e POSTGRES_PASSWORD=mysecretpassword \
-e POSTGRES_DB=jetkvm \
-d postgres
# Copy the .env.example file to .env and populate it with the correct values
cp .env.example .env
# Install dependencies
npm install
# Deploy the existing database migrations
npx prisma migrate deploy
# Start the production server on port 3000
npm run dev
Production
# Copy the .env.example file to .env and populate it with the correct values
cp .env.example .env
# Install dependencies
npm install
# Deploy the existing database migrations
# Needs to run on new release
npx prisma migrate deploy
# Start the production server on port 3000
npm run start
